Output 67a8e8dcacd07bf56e0e5fd5136618ef7f50e9c2d38a761b3c55c57ed3c8a121:30

value
25983292
script pubkey
OP_0 OP_PUSHBYTES_20 44a8b7ee81e7db70771fe2e101260a2cd115c6c4
address
ltc1qgj5t0m5puldhqaclutsszfs29ng3t3kygqtcpt
transaction
67a8e8dcacd07bf56e0e5fd5136618ef7f50e9c2d38a761b3c55c57ed3c8a121
spent
true